This is a little game made by two second year students of the Videogame Design and Development degree. It's a 2D platformer with two levels where the player must change between maps to complete the game. It has been made using C++, SDL and pugi libraries. The maps have been made using Tiled.

You can jump after attacking or falling from a grid, box or the ground.
To jump from walls you must stop sliding.
Boxes have opposite positions in each map so, if you think you can't continue, try changing the map.
While gripped to a box you can only jump and only after it has stopped moving.
If you start a New Game the previous saved file will be deleted.
